  14. stephenh

    Tyres for 7's Speed Series

    It's down to weight, mainly, LoneWolf. When I was sprinting regularly, I had 2 sets of wheels; 13" for sprinting and 15" for road use and the occasional trackday. Back then though, we were allowed to use list 1B tyres, which then included all or most of the semi-slick trackday tyres, in super soft rubber mix. Then those tyres were taken out of list 1B, and ceased to be approved for road use, so if you continued to run them you had to run in non-roadgoing class, so up against those using slick tyres. Although the weight saving isn't huge, remember it is all unsprung weight, so it is relevant to how well the suspension can deal with undulations in the road surface at racing speeds.

  21. Two7

    Tyres for 7's Speed Series

    If it is dry toyo r888r seem popular. Road legal and class 1b for mot road going cars like my westy. My avon zv7 on the other hand are now no longer allowed, bog standard road tyres group 1a for years, i used in the wet and driving to tesco but I have to throw them away now because avon got taken over by nova. Uniroyal rain sport are supposed to be good 1a.

  25. going on with making my track westfield road (almost ) legal ... got headlights and hosings (aliexpress). Unfortunately, due to my own oversight, I ordered two pairs of lamps instead of one pair A few small modifications were needed right away — the screws securing the lamp housing bracket were sticking into the inside of the housing, which made it impossible to fit the insert (the actual lamp). They had to be mounted the other way around, with the rounded heads facing inside the housing and the nuts on the outside. And yeah… they’re kind of big and heavy compared to my previous “lamps,” which I made myself from LED strip, an aluminum tube, and duct tape Ideally, lightweight, smaller Dominator-type LED headlights with built-in sidelights would be best. Unfortunately, I couldn’t find any. I did find Dominator-style lights with an LED DRL ring, but without sidelights. Maybe on the next attempt. I spent so much time drilling different elements to reduce weight, and now these bricks sit high and far out front — the worst possible position for ballast… But hey, it will be the same in that area as a brand-new Westfield SE.NA! (just faster )
